Ticket #1287 — Vault locked; N+1 fix blocked

Deploy of the Graphlet N+1 fix (batched resolver for order lookups) is blocked. Vault holding the schema-signing key sealed after the patch host rebooted. Support: unseal from the Dornbridge admin node, then rerun the release job. No other action needed. Unseal prompt requires the current recovery passphrase, listed below.

unlock words, hahip-baduf: holwyn-istath-julvan

## Vendor Note: Catalog Cache Invalidation

Our catalog vendor, Mercantry Systems, pushes invalidation events on a fifteen-minute cycle, so stale prices inside that window are expected and should not be escalated. If staleness persists beyond one hour, gather the affected SKUs and the last sync timestamp before contacting them. Their integrations desk handles invalidation tickets and can be reached below.

alerts address for kajog-tadup: druox@plorvanet.internal

## Support

The Fairmont Autocomplete Widget ships with typed hooks for plugin authors. Check the extension guide before filing issues, and include your widget version and browser details in any report. For integration questions, schema changes, or to request new event callbacks, reach the Fairmont maintainers directly.

escalation mailbox, bafog-fafog: ulador@paliqlabs.internal

Subject: Thumbnail queue cut-over done

All,

Cut-over from the old Pindrop renderer to the Gullwing thumbnail queue finished at 02:10. Backlog drained in 40 minutes. Old workers are stopped but not deleted; remove after two weeks if no regressions. Alerts now route through the Harrowmere monitor. Rollback steps are in the wiki. The live configuration is recorded below for reference.

settings of bajof-tahag:
zorwyn:
  pin: 8859
  metrics_host: metrics.zorwyn.qorvellabs.internal
  tenant: norys
  seal: seal_a67ce0a9